33 lines
682 B
Java
33 lines
682 B
Java
package ch.hevs.isi.db;
|
|
|
|
|
|
import ch.hevs.isi.core.DataPoint;
|
|
import ch.hevs.isi.core.DataPointListener;
|
|
|
|
public class DatabaseConnector implements DataPointListener {
|
|
private static DatabaseConnector mySelf = null;
|
|
|
|
private DatabaseConnector (){
|
|
|
|
}
|
|
|
|
public static DatabaseConnector getMySelf(){
|
|
if (mySelf == null){
|
|
mySelf = new DatabaseConnector();
|
|
}
|
|
return mySelf;
|
|
}
|
|
public void initialize(String url){
|
|
|
|
}
|
|
|
|
private void pushToDatabase(DataPoint dp){
|
|
System.out.println(dp.toString() + " -> Database");
|
|
}
|
|
|
|
@Override
|
|
public void onNewValue(DataPoint dp) {
|
|
pushToDatabase(dp);
|
|
}
|
|
}
|